About Sakamo

Sakamo Bai is a resident of Pali and is the sole breadwinner of her family. She owns farming land and cultivates castor. She is requesting a loan to help cover the cost incurred for cultivation in the upcoming season. This money will help her in paying for the labour and the fertilizer used for the cultivation. She has been cultivating castor for six years and this is the first time she is requesting a loan. Her husband is her motivation to work hard and stand on her own. In spite of adversity, she strongly believes that one day she will build a house on her own in the land that she has earned. Invest in Sakamo now!

Registered under the societies registration act on 2nd February 2015, the federation comprises 4000 women. The federation works with the tribal communities of Rajasthan. The main source of income for the communities here is agriculture, stone-cutting and daily wage labour. With a strong presence of moneylenders charging exorbitant rates of interest, these communities have no other choice but to borrow at these rates to keep their business going. Ghoomar has been working tirelessly with these communities to help them build their livelihoods in a more sustainable manner by providing them with access to low cost credit and supporting their livelihood activities.
